Moe's Southwest Grill Store locator Huntsville

Moe's Southwest Grill stores located in Huntsville: 1
Largest shopping mall with Moe's Southwest Grill store in Huntsville: Westbury Square Shopping center 

Moe's Southwest Grill store locator Huntsville displays complete list and huge database of Moe's Southwest Grill stores, factory stores, shops and boutiques in Huntsville (Alabama). Moe's Southwest Grill information: map of Huntsville, shopping hours, contact information.

Moe's Southwest Grill stores in Huntsville, Alabama on Map

Moe's Southwest Grill   stores in Huntsville, Alabama on Map

Moe's Southwest Grill store locations in Huntsville (Alabama)

More Moe's Southwest Grill stores in Alabama - AL

Search all Moe's Southwest Grill stores located in Huntsville, Alabama

Specify Moe's Southwest Grill store location:

Go to the city Moe's Southwest Grill locator